City Council:

 

AN ORDINANCE AUTHORIZING THE MAYOR

TO ENTER INTO A MEMORANDUM OF

UNDERSTANDING WITH WESTCHESTER

NEIGHBORHOOD HEALTH CENTER FOR THE

INSTALLATION OF A CITY RESOURCE KIOSK

AT THEIR MOUNT VERNON FACILITY

 

Whereas, in correspondence dated August 8, 2025, the Commissioner of the Department of Planning & Community Development formally requested authorization for the Mayor to enter into a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) with Westchester Neighborhood Health Center to install a City Resource Kiosk at WNHC’s Mount Vernon facility, substantially in the form attached hereto, subject to such modifications as may be deemed necessary by Corporation Counsel; and

Whereas, the City of Mount Vernon is committed to expanding equitable access to essential municipal services for all residents; and

Whereas, the Westchester Neighborhood Health Center (WNHC) has offered to partner with the City by hosting a City-operated Resource Kiosk at its Mount Vernon facility; and

Whereas, the proposed electronic kiosk will serve as a one-stop access point for residents to connect with a wide range of City resources and programs, including but not limited to:

                     Filing housing and quality-of-life complaints;

                     Accessing senior services and benefits;

                     Exploring youth and recreation opportunities; and

                     Learning about veterans’ programs and support services; and

Whereas, under the proposed Memorandum of Understanding (MOU), the City will be responsible for the installation and maintenance of the kiosk at its own expense, with the kiosk remaining the property of the City; and

Whereas, WNHC will host the kiosk and provide reasonable access for City maintenance and support personnel, at no additional cost to the City; and

Whereas, the kiosks were purchased with grant funds, and the smart tablet for operation will be provided from the Department of Management Services’ existing inventory, thus incurring no new expense to the City; and

Whereas, this partnership will bring municipal government resources closer to the community and improve service delivery for Mount Vernon residents; Now, Therefore, Be It Resolved That

The City of Mount Vernon, in City Council convened, does hereby ordain and enact:

Section 1.                     Authorization.  The Mayor is hereby authorized to enter into a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) with Westchester Neighborhood Health Center to install a City Resource Kiosk at WNHC’s Mount Vernon facility, substantially in the form attached hereto, subject to such modifications as may be deemed necessary by Corporation Counsel.

Section 2.                     Responsibilities.  Under the MOU, the City shall:

(a)                     Install and maintain the kiosk at its own expense;

(b)                     Provide the smart tablet from the Department of Management Services’ existing inventory; and

(c)                     Retain ownership of the kiosk and its equipment.

WNHC shall:

(a)                     Host the kiosk at its facility; and

                     Provide reasonable access to City personnel for maintenance and support.

Section 3.                     Purpose.  The purpose of the City Resource Kiosk is to enhance public access to City services, provide residents with direct digital access to essential programs, and promote government outreach through convenient, community-based engagement.

Section 4.                     No Additional Fiscal Impact.  This initiative shall have no additional fiscal impact on the City budget, as the kiosk equipment was purchased with grant funds, and the smart tablet will be supplied from existing City resources

Section 5.                     Effective Date.  This Ordinance shall take effect immediately upon approval by the Board of Estimate and Contract.
